Located in the scenic Sequatchie Valley of Southeast Tennessee, this 158.45± surveyed-acre recreational and hunting property offers a rare opportunity to own a large off-grid tract with direct frontage on the Little Sequatchie River. Situated beyond West Coppinger Cove Road in Sequatchie, Tennessee, this Marion County property features year-round water, diverse terrain, mature hardwood timber, established trail systems, and exceptional wildlife habitat. Access begins on a county-maintained paved road before transitioning to an ATV trail that fords the Little Sequatchie River and continues across the property via a prescriptive easement. This unique access provides outstanding privacy and seclusion while remaining accessible year-round. The Little Sequatchie River flows through the property, creating an excellent water source for wildlife and adding significant recreational appeal. Rolling hardwood ridges, level bottomlands, and open meadow areas provide ideal locations for hunting, camping, food plots, future improvements, or an off-grid retreat. Steeper sections create natural travel corridors and secluded bedding areas that support healthy populations of whitetail deer, eastern wild turkey, and small game. The property is predominantly wooded with mature oak, hickory, poplar, and scattered cedar, offering abundant mast production, excellent wildlife habitat, and long-term timber value potential. An established internal trail system provides miles of access for ATVs, horseback riding, hiking, hunting, and game retrieval, making it easy to explore every corner of the property. Located within convenient driving distance of Chattanooga, this tract offers the perfect balance of accessibility and rural seclusion. Whether you're looking for a premier hunting property, recreational retreat, land investment, or future off-grid homesite, this remarkable Marion County property offers the natural resources, privacy, and versatility to bring your vision to life.
